Which fundamental intermolecular force is primarily responsible for the high tensile strength, close packing, and crystalline nature of polyamide fibres like Nylon-6 and Nylon-6,6?

Nylons are polyamides. The presence of highly polar amide ($-CONH-$) linkages allows the formation of strong intermolecular hydrogen bonds between the carbonyl oxygen of one chain and the amide hydrogen of an adjacent chain, leading to close packing and high tensile strength.
